Transaction 4d63df5bb17f1491205a5a2370a90decd15b223e5cd99efafdc97e761aa67128
1 Input
1 Output
-
4d63df5bb17f1491205a5a2370a90decd15b223e5cd99efafdc97e761aa67128:0
- value
- 8630419
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dcef8fef99fa41391b68f871e2e883818c37bf92 OP_EQUAL
- address
- 3MqDZpi4jmncmCkESCC1peFGmAVN7W9f7H